Velvets not quite off the bulls
« on: August 20, 2009, 07:43:33 PM »
Had several nice bulls on the cams monday and some had the velvet hanging, but this one has some on the top of the antlers.  Also some old scars from a few years back on it's rump.  Had horses that got cut and sometimes white hair would grow replace the natural colored hair after healing.  Sure looks like another bull got him when he was younger.
